Overview of an Abandoned Cart Email

A large majority of eCommerce operators have heard of abandoned carts. However, you might not have heard that an abandoned cart email can put your back on track to earning revenue from your eCommerce store.

An abandoned cart email represents the electronic message you send to a customer that added some of your products to an online shopping cart, but for some unknown reason left the car full, without paying for the merchandise.

You send an abandoned cart email as a subtle reminder that the cart remains full for the completion of a sale.

Get Personal

You know how spam emails can turn you off faster than a traffic jam during rush hour. How do you overcome the tendency many people have to delete emails, without first opening them to see what the message is all about?

The answer is to personalize the subject line and make sure the abandoned cart email is from a real person.

By personalizing an abandoned cart email, you will make your customers feel special because you are taking the time to reach out to them. Sending a personalized email also builds trust in your brand, since it demonstrates you care about your products and services. As you know, building trust is the most important factor in developing long-term relationships with your customers.

When you send a personalized abandoned cart email, remember to include a direct link to the products your customers had in their shopping carts at the time of abandonment.

Add Value to Motivate Your Customers to Take Action?

Why do so many consumers abandon their online shopping carts? The answer is not clear, but one factor is always present.

The cart got so full it went over the shopping budget.

How does your business motivate your customers to take action by completing online ecommerce transactions? By throwing in a little financial incentive that saves your customers money on an eCommerce transaction.

Send abandoned cart emails that include coupons and invitations to participate in discounted promotions in return for the completion of an online sale. When a customer sees an email that contains a way to save money, chances are good he or she will return to the abandoned online shopping cart to take advantage of the savings.

This is an especially effective way to convert a cart that was abandoned online by one of your regular customers.

Send Automated Emails

As a business owner or operator, you wish there were more than 24 hours in each day. You have to juggle dozens of responsibilities simultaneously, which makes tending to the issue of abandoned carts a mere blip on your hectic radar screen.

It doesn’t have to be that way.

In fact, you can reduce the number of abandoned carts by not even having to check your eCommerce store on a daily basis. Automated emails, which you write well in advance of sending them, offer a highly effective way for you to stay on top of abandoned online shopping carts.

You might be asking “Doesn’t automation make personalizing emails out of the question.” Good question, but no, automating your emails does not eliminate the conversion strategy called personalization. You can pre-write personalized abandoned cart emails to be sent out weeks from now.

Automating the emails that convert abandoned carts not only saves you time, it generates more revenue for your business.

Insert Customer Reviews within Abandoned Cart Emails

Sometimes, some of your customers just need a gentle nudge to get them through the checkout lane of your eCommerce store. What is the most effective strategy for gently nudging your customers? The answer is by including a few customer reviews in the emails you send out to convert abandoned carts. We like to feel our purchasing decisions are validated by the positive experiences other consumers have enjoyed using the same products and services.

It’s the opposite of peer pressure; it’s called peer support.

You can start the customer review section by writing something like this: “Let’s see what some of our customers have to say after using our XYZ product.”

You have several ways to gather customer reviews. A site such as Trustpilot puts customer reviews from different platforms in one convenient place for quick access. You can also use the customer reviews left on your business website, as well as glean customer reviews from popular sites like Yelp and Google.
